Key Features and Performance Specs
The heart of this tool is a 2-stroke, 80.7cc engine. It delivers plenty of power for both blowing and cutting tasks. Husqvarna has tuned it for responsive acceleration and steady performance under load.
Here are the core specifications that matter for your work:
- Engine Displacement: 80.7 cc
- Power Output: 3.4 kW / 4.6 hp
- Blower Air Speed: Over 300 km/h (186 mph)
- Blower Air Volume: Over 1200 m³/h (706 cfm)
- Cutting Swath: 540 mm (21.3 inches) with supplied blade
- Fuel Tank Volume: 1.3 liters (0.34 US gallons)

Choosing the Right Cutting Attachment
Using the correct attachment is crucial for safety and results. Here’s a quick guide:
- Standard Trimmer Head & Nylon Line: Best for lawns, fine weeds, and edging.
- 3-Tooth Grass Blade: Ideal for thick grass, weeds, and light brush.
- 8-Tooth Brush Blade: Use for heavy brush, brambles, and small saplings up to about 10cm thick.
- Circular Saw Blade: For the heaviest clearing of woody plants and trees (requires specific training and safety gear).
Step-by-Step: Starting and Operating Your 580BTS Mark III
Getting started correctly ensures a long life for your tool. Follow these steps for a safe and proper start.
- Fuel Mix: Always use fresh, high-quality 2-stroke oil mixed with unleaded gasoline. The recommended ratio for the 580BTS Mark III is 1:50. Using old fuel or the wrong mix is a common cause of starting problems.
- Pre-Start Check: Ensure the blower tube or trimmer head is securely attached. Check that the harness is properly connected to the tool. Inspect the area for debris like stones or wire.
- Starting Procedure: Place the tool on a flat surface. Set the choke to the cold start position. Press the fuel pump (primer bulb) 5-6 times. Press the decompression valve. Pull the starter cord smoothly until you feel resistance, then give it a strong pull. Once the engine fires, move the choke to the run position.
- During Operation: Let the engine warm up for a minute. Always keep a firm grip with both hands. Use a smooth, sweeping motion for both blowing and cutting. Never raise the tool above waist height.
Maintenance Tips for Longevity
Professional tools need professional care. A simple maintenance routine will prevent most issues and keep your tool running strong for seasons to come.
- After Each Use: Wipe down the tool. Clean the air filter by tapping it out. Visually inspect for loose bolts or damage.
- Weekly (or every 20 hours): Clean the air filter more thoroughly with soap and water. Let it dry completely before reinstalling. Check the spark plug condition.
- Seasonally: Replace the air filter and spark plug. Clean the fuel filter inside the tank. Check and grease the gearhead at the end of the shaft.
- Storage: For long-term storage, always drain the fuel tank completely or use a fuel stabilizer. Store the tool in a dry, clean place.
